Maximizing Profits in Pool Services
Use Left/Right to seek, Home/End to jump to start or end. Hold shift to jump forward or backward.
In this episode of Talking Pools, Lee & Shane discuss the importance of database management, effective pricing strategies, and the perceived value of services in the pool industry. They emphasize the need for businesses to maintain clean databases for better marketing and profitability, explore how to set competitive prices without undervaluing services, and highlight the significance of communicating value to customers to enhance satisfaction and retention. In this conversation, the speakers discuss the importance of quality over quantity in business, emphasizing the need for a solid understanding of costs and pricing strategies. They highlight the significance of transparency with employees regarding business expenses and the value of time and services. The discussion also covers the careful consideration required when expanding service offerings, calculating equipment costs, and accounting for all business expenses. Ultimately, the speakers stress the importance of valuing one's skills and professionalism in the industry.
